    Well btc is again below the $100,000 level and is even below the $90k level. So, is it the best time or level to buy for a big target, or wait for further correction?

    In this article, we will try to analyze bitcoin for it’s next target and direction for the best buy level.

    Bitcoin Next Target

    • Price: $88,606.00
    • Market Capitalization: Approximately $1.7 trillion
    • 24-Hour Trading Volume: $71.84 billion
    • Circulating Supply: 19.83 million BTC
    • Total Supply: 19.83 million BTC
    • Max Supply: 21 million BTC
    Bitcoin Next Target

    Price broke above $100K resistance, making new ATH (all-time-highs) at $108K, where it got rejected again. Price dipped back to 200-day Moving Average (support) two times and bounced off of it. Upside potential back to $100K or $108K. 

    Technical Overview

    • Trend: Short-term trend is Down, Medium-term trend is Down, Long-term trend is Neutral.
    • Momentum: Price is neither overbought nor oversold currently.
    • Support and Resistance: Nearest Support Zone is $75,000.00, then $60,000.00. Nearest Resistance Zone is $100,000.00, then $108,000.00.

    Recent News

    • Bitcoin’s Price Fluctuations: Bitcoin recently experienced significant volatility, trading as high as $92,800 earlier today before dropping to $89,570.
    • Upcoming White House Crypto Summit: President Donald Trump is set to host a crypto summit at the White House on Friday, where more details about the national crypto reserve are expected to be unveiled.

    Bitcoin’s recent price movements and upcoming regulatory discussions underscore the importance of staying informed and exercising caution when engaging with the cryptocurrency market.
